What you'll see and do

  1. Plitvice Lakes National Park

    Take a walk through Croatia’s most visited national park, a Unesco world heritage site - Plitvice Lakes! Plitvice Lakes is one of the oldest national parks in Southeast Europe and the largest national park in Croatia. The national park is world-famous for its lakes arranged in cascades. These lakes are a result of the confluence of several small rivers and subterranean karst rivers. 18km of wooden footbridges and pathways gives you an opportunity to explore 16 interconnected lakes arranged in cascades. This heavily forested park hides 75 endemic plants,55 different species of orchids,160 bird species, and even bears and wolfs!
